Mazak VCN 510CII Specifications
| # Axis | 4 |
|---|---|
| Table Size | 51.18" x 21.65" |
| Power | 25 HP |
| Maximum Spindle Speed | 12,000 RPM |
| Atc Capacity | 30 |
| Control System | CNC (Mazatrol Matrix CNC Color Control) |

This model, known for its robust performance, features a generous working envelope with travel dimensions of 41.34 inches in the X-axis, 20.08 inches in the Y-axis, and 20.08 inches in the Z-axis. With a powerful 25 hp spindle and an impressive maximum speed of 12,000 RPM, the VCN 510CII is designed to handle a variety of machining tasks efficiently. Additionally, its 30-tool automatic tool changer enhances productivity by minimizing downtime between operations. The MAZAK VCN 510CII is equipped with a 40-taper spindle, making it compatible with a wide range of tooling options, which is essential for shops looking to expand their capabilities.
The machine's table dimensions of 21.65 inches by 51.18 inches provide ample space for larger workpieces, allowing for versatility in various machining applications. Furthermore, the MAZATROL MATRIX CNC color control system offers intuitive programming and operation, making it user-friendly for machinists of all skill levels.
